    Cops want masks outlawed

    With the dust not entirely settled from the latest annual bottle-throwing, fireworks-shooting protest targeting his forces, a top cop yesterday used the opportunity to try to revive a Montreal police campaign to outlaw masks.

    A similar effort petered out last year, following objections by civil-liberties groups.

    “If people were wearing masks, it was to hide their identities – possibly because they wanted to commit offences,” Chief Insp. Sylvain Lemay told rue.frontenac.

    A leading Japanese politician espouses a 9/11 fantasy

    "YUKIHISA FUJITA is an influential member of the ruling Democratic Party of Japan. As chief of the DPJ's international department and head of the Research Committee on Foreign Affairs in the upper house of Japan's parliament, to which he was elected in 2007, he is a Brahmin in the foreign policy establishment of Washington's most important East Asian ally. He also seems to think that America's rendering of the events of Sept. 11, 2001, is a gigantic hoax.
